AGF II operates on a massive 5 GB sample library, recorded in pristine 24-bit/44.1kHz audio. To ensure absolute realism, Ample Sound recorded every single fret across all six strings. They deliberately avoided artificial pitch-shifting or processing during the core tracking phase. This ensures that when you trigger a note on the keyboard, you hear the exact physical resonance, string tension, and tonal character of that specific fret on a real Stratocaster. The v2.0.2 engine handles polyphonic legato transitions flawlessly. You can play smooth chords and slide them entirely up or down the fretboard. The built-in slide smoother ensures that pitch glides feel organic, mimicking the physical friction of a finger moving across nickel frets. With a single click, the plugin duplicates the guitar signal and pans the layers to the hard left and hard right. This recreates a true double-tracked studio guitar sound, instantly widening your stereo field without requiring multiple MIDI tracks. 3.
